Hello After we have updated our RADIUS server i can not authenticate any more. If i use 'radpwtst' on the commandline, everything is ok. See this: ---cut here--- root@myfirewall [/usr/local/radius] >>bin/radpwtst -d ./raddb/ -p 1645 -s localhost me@myrealm Merit AAA server Version 3.6B mway3.44 , licensed software COPYRIGHT 1992, 1993, 1994, 1995, 1996, 1997, 1998 THE REGENTS OF THE UNIVERSITY OF MICHIGAN ALL RIGHTS RESERVED Password: 'me@myrealm' authentication OK rout@myfirewall [/usr/local/radius] >> ---cut here--- The firewall can not authenticate. Here is what happens on the screen: ---cut here--- hajo@workstation ~$ telnet myfirewall 259 Trying 333.333.333.333... Connected to myfirewall.domain.de. Escape character is '^]'. Check Point FireWall-1 Client Authentication Server running on myfirewall User: me@myrealm RADIUS password: ******* RADIUS servers not responding ---cut here--- The RADIUS logfile states, that the Authentication ist OK but the firewall seems to ignore this answer. After 2 retries, the 'RADIUS servers not responding' messages is sent out. What is the Authentication Client expecting? Can anybody help me?
